This summer's short adventure in Tunisia began by leaving the port of call and heading out on a highway toward the center of Tunis. As we passed the city and headed to suburbia, desolate scenes such as the one seen in today's entry unfolded. Many suburban houses in the distance. Very few cars on the road. For some reason looking at this picture makes me sad. I wonder what happened on this street - the skid marks in the foreground suggest breaking by some car, but I can't envision this road being heavily traveled by cars or pedestrians.
